Possible Causes of Floor Water Damage

Water damage to floors in Novi often results from plumbing issues, such as burst pipes or leaking fixtures, that allow water to seep into the flooring materials. Heavy storms and flooding can also lead to significant water intrusion, especially if gutters and drainage systems are clogged or improperly maintained. Additionally, appliance failures, like malfunctioning dishwashers or washing machines, are common culprits that cause water to spill onto the floor.

Another common cause includes roof leaks that allow rainwater to penetrate through ceilings and onto the floors below. Building foundation cracks can also let groundwater seep into basements and lower levels, causing substantial damage to flooring surfaces. Prolonged high humidity and poorly ventilated areas can foster mold growth, which often coincides with water exposure, further degrading the integrity of your floors.

How Can We Fix That

Our team begins by thoroughly assessing the extent of the water damage to determine whether the damage is limited to the surface or has penetrated deeper into the subfloor and foundation. We use advanced moisture detection tools to identify hidden dampness and ensure complete removal of water. Once the affected areas are identified, we begin the extraction process to remove standing water quickly and prevent further deterioration.

Next, we focus on drying and dehumidifying the affected areas. Using industrial-grade equipment, our experts accelerate the drying process, ensuring that all moisture is eliminated.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and structural weakening. After the drying stage, we perform a detailed cleaning and sanitization to remove bacteria, mold spores, and odors associated with water intrusion.

Finally, we offer comprehensive restoration services, which may include replacing damaged flooring, subfloor repairs, and sealing vulnerable areas to prevent future issues. Our team ensures that the repaired sections match the existing flooring for a seamless look. Frequently Asked Questions

How do I know if my floor needs water damage restoration?

If your floor shows signs of warping, discoloration, or a musty odor, it likely needs professional evaluation. Promptly contacting water damage experts can prevent further deterioration and mold growth.

How long does the drying process typically take?

The drying time varies depending on the extent of damage and moisture levels. Most projects are completed within 24 to 72 hours, but severe cases may require additional time for complete drying and restoration.

Can I water-damage my floors myself?

While minor spills can be cleaned and dried at home, extensive water damage requires professional equipment and expertise. DIY efforts may miss hidden moisture, leading to mold and structural issues later.

Will my floors need to be replaced after water damage?

Not always. Many floors can be salvaged with proper drying, cleaning, and repairs. However, severely damaged flooring or subflooring might necessitate replacement to ensure safety and durability.

How can I prevent water damage to my floors?

Regular maintenance of plumbing, gutters, and drainage systems, along with prompt repairs of leaks, can significantly reduce the risk. Proper ventilation and moisture control throughout your property also help maintain a dry environment.
